If you live in Cote d’Ivoire, formerly known as the Ivory Coast, the government wants to give you a free house. All you have to do is show up on time for work. Yes, that’s it. The government believes work tardiness is so bad, it’s hurting the economy.
Pitching the slogan ‘African time’ is killing Africa, let’s fight it, organizers hope to raise public awareness of how missed appointments, delayed business meetings or even late buses cut productivity in a country where rampant tardiness is the norm. The incentive to get people to show up on time— a new house.
The first winner of the top prize, legal adviser Narcisse Akar, was given a free villa worth $60,000.
